Woman is killed in hit-and-run crash

A WOMAN was killed in an apparent hit-and-run accident on Wednesday morning in Huntington Beach.

UPDATE: The woman killed in the Wednesday morning traffic accident in Huntington Beach has been identified. According to the HBPD, she is Tina Boring, 53, of Huntington Beach.

–––––––

An investigation is underway into a fatal hit-and-run accident that took place in Huntington Beach on Wednesday morning.

According to Sgt. Julio Mendez of the HBPD’s traffic unit, the incident was reported at 12:40 a.m. in the area of Seapoint Drive, north of Palm Avenue.

Arriving officers found the body of a woman lying in the street.

Investigators believe that a vehicle traveling north on Seapoint from Palm struck the woman in the roadway and fled the area.

There’s no suspect information and the woman has not been identified.
